In legalism, strict adherence to laws and regulations is emphasized, and the belief is that clear rewards and severe punishments are essential for maintaining order and control within society. This approach prioritizes the enforcement of laws to deter wrongdoing and promote compliance, fostering a sense of fear and obligation among the populace. By rewarding compliance and punishing transgressions harshly, legalism aims to create a stable and harmonious society, though it often raises ethical concerns about justice and individual rights. Ultimately, the focus is on maintaining authority and social order rather than fostering moral or personal development.

How did the members of Qin dynasty apply the teachings of hanfeizi?

Han Fei- Legalism assumed that people were naturally evil and always acted to avoid punishment while simultaneously trying to achieve gains; Thus, the law must severely punish any unwanted action, while at the same time reward those who follow it.
